Quick Summary

PV-50A-01XL-B-15 Photovoltaic fuses are designed to reliably protect DC solar power systems from overcurrent in PV arrays and inverters. Engineers often wrestle with protection that fits bolted connections, provides clear fault indication, and withstands outdoor, rapid cycling environments. This device carries UL Listed, IEC 60269, and CSA certification, with CE RoHS marking, aligning with global solar installations. By combining gPV class construction, a centre status indicator, and a compact bolted-footprint, it delivers safer, faster protection while reducing downtime and maintenance costs for commercial and utility-scale projects.

Extended Description

PV-50A-01XL-B-15 Eaton: Eaton Bussmann series Fuse-link, high speed, 50 A, DC 1500 V, 01XL, gPV, UL, IEC, bolted connections
